Plastic vent is made by Detmar. Some Blackfins also used this vent, retail should be under $11.00 ea.

mine are the same dimensions that scooter posted. found replacement plastic ones at my local marine store for $10.99. the owner said they are also used on some silverton models. west marine didn't have that size in stock.
